Detailed Description

This C++ class implements the second example plugin for the step-by-step tutorial.

It extends the first example by using configuration language variables to influence the processing.

Member Function Documentation

◆ prepare()

void example2_t::prepare ( mhaconfig_t signal_info)
virtual

Plugin preparation.

This plugin checks that the input signal has the waveform domain and contains enough channels.

Parameters
signal_infoStructure containing a description of the form of the signal (domain, number of channels, frames per block, sampling rate.

Implements MHAPlugin::plugin_t< int >.

◆ release()

void example2_t::release ( void  )
virtual

Undo restrictions posed in prepare.

Reimplemented from MHAPlugin::plugin_t< int >.

◆ process()

mha_wave_t * example2_t::process ( mha_wave_t signal)

Signal processing performed by the plugin.


This plugin multiplies the signal in the selected audio channel by the configured factor.

Parameters
signalPointer to the input signal structure.
Returns
Returns a pointer to the input signal structure, with a the signal modified by this plugin. (In-place processing)
